Beyonce is in hot water after being hit with a lawsuit for ripping-off a few lines from a 1995 Hungarian song.

Singer Monika Juhasz Miczura, a.k.a. Mitsou, is suing Beyonce, Jay Z and Timbaland for copyright infringement over the opening a cappella of “Drunk In Love.”;

Filed on December 12, Mitsou claims that summer hit sampled her 1995 song “Bajba, Bajba Pelem” without appropriate consent. “Mitsou never gave permission or consent, and never granted any of the Defendants permission, to use her voice for any purpose,” the court papers said.

Not only is the Hungarian singer requesting undisclosed damages, but she’s also demanding that the song be prevented from airing without her original vocals.
